Outplacement Workshops For Hourly/Non-Exempt Personnel

- First Transitions will provide hourly/non-exempt personnel with eight hours of workshop time covering the entire job search process. This workshop will emphasize: the need for a positive mental attitude; time/financial budgeting; skills analysis; resume development; the job search — who and how to contact; communications; do's and don’ts of interviewing; wage and benefit checklist.

- The optimum size of the workshop is 8 – 12 participants.

- The participants should also be provided with limited individual counseling (one-on-one). We estimate 2 hours will be sufficient to finalize the resume, discuss campaign approaches, and conduct a practice interview.

- Additional phone assistance is available on request of the participant. There is no additional charge for ongoing phone contact.
